Asiate occupies the thirty-fifth floor of the Mandarin Oriental at Columbus Circle — the floor-to-ceiling glass holds the full Central Park view at eye level with the trees, the contemporary American kitchen is calibrated to the room rather than the inverse. The Sunday brunch is the city institution that does not get listed in the brunch guides because the hotel keeps the booking pressure controlled.

Book the window table for the noon Sunday brunch, take the seafood tower, the eggs benedict, the champagne. The address is the right answer for the brunch that wants the highest view in the city and the only Central Park sightline at the proper level.
